Updated Sequence Information for TEM beta -Lactamase Genes

Sylvie Goussard* and Patrice Courvalin

Unité des Agents Antibactériens, Institut Pasteur, 75724 Paris Cedex 15, France

Received 24 June 1998/Returned for modification 26 October 1998/Accepted 17 November 1998

The sequences of the promoter regions and of the structural genes for 13 penicillinase, extended-spectrum, and inhibitor-resistant TEM-type beta -lactamases have been determined, and an updated blaTEM gene nomenclature is proposed.
